Today I'll show you a very old song of mine, this was made in the middle of 2010, just when I was starting to get "seriously" into using FL Studio, and moving away from using loops to compose. (loops are fine IF you edit them, or create something new with them (drum breaks etc.) not use entire melodies because I was too unskilled to craft them ) I had no knowledge of mixing, mastering or music theory. Nope, didn't even know what a scale was, made this entire piece by experimentation using my ear. So yeah, flashback to now: I decided it would be fun and nostalgic to re-mix (aka correct the mix), and remaster (aka actually master instead of just using a limiter) some older tunes and this is the first one: https://soundcloud.com/cbr/journey-through-the-fabric-of Everything you hear, soundwise here is kept original I just fixed the mix and master. Got any older songs any of you want to post? Share them with me in this thread I find re-mixing and remastering a fun practice and it really helps you understand how much you've grown as an artist.
